hamsters can have a variety of colors, including golden and black. the allele
for golden fur (g) is dominant over the allele for black fur (g). the table
shows the genotypes and phenotypes for a small population of hamsters.
what is the frequency of the golden phenotype?
a. 13/50
b. 13/38
c. 37/50
d. 13/38
submit
Step1: Calculate total number of hamsters
Total number of hamsters = \(12 + 25+13=50\)
Step2: Calculate number of golden - phenotyped hamsters
Number of golden - phenotyped hamsters = \(12 + 25 = 37\)
Step3: Calculate the frequency of the golden phenotype
Frequency=\(\frac{\text{Number of golden - phenotyped hamsters}}{\text{Total number of hamsters}}=\frac{37}{50}\)
